This is a great pub but don’t take your dog. Having been inside with two small dogs since around 8pm (with permission) and spending around £40, at 10pm we were told “can’t serve you as dogs aren’t allowed inside after 10pm” which is fine. We said we’ll take the drinks onto the terrace but told no you can’t have dogs outside either after 10pm. Stroppy bar stewardess told us all Newquay is like that based on her experience of working in two bars. I don’t think so as we were warmly welcomed at at least 6 others bars over the week. Avoid if you love dogs

Berries is far bigger inside than you think. The outside dosnt really sell it to its great potential inside. Friendly & clean. Quick service. Worth a pint or two. I haven't rayed food as we were drinking. Interesting gaff as there's different mezzanine floors allover it. Plenty room Inc sofa's yo chill on.Pool tables etc.Worth a pint.Dave
